Combined communication optical cable and lightning protection wire

Optical Ground Wire (OPGW) cables integrate lightning protection and high-speed fiber optic communication in a single overhead cable for power transmission lines.

Overview

OPGW cables are specialized composite cables installed at the top of high-voltage transmission lines. They serve a dual purpose: the metallic outer layers act as a ground wire, safely conducting lightning strikes and fault currents to the ground, while the embedded optical fibers provide a secure channel for high-speed data transmission, supporting SCADA, EMS, and real-time monitoring systems . This integration eliminates the need for separate communication infrastructure, reducing installation and maintenance costs .

Structure

An OPGW cable typically consists of:

  • Central metallic tube (aluminum or stainless steel) housing the optical fibers.
  • Optical fibers (single-mode or multi-mode) for data transmission.
  • Surrounding layers of aluminum-clad steel or alloy wires providing mechanical strength and lightning protection.
  • Optional double-layer or asymmetric configurations for long spans or harsh environmental conditions . This robust construction ensures high tensile strength, corrosion resistance, and durability under extreme weather, including high winds, ice, and temperature variations .

Applications

OPGW cables are widely used in:

  • High-voltage (HV), extra-high voltage (EHV), and ultra-high voltage (UHV) transmission lines.
  • Smart grid communication, enabling real-time monitoring, fault detection, and substation automation.
  • Telecommunication networks, where utilities lease excess fiber capacity for broadband services.
  • Grid protection and monitoring, supporting SCADA and EMS systems for efficient power distribution .

Benefits

  • Dual functionality: Combines lightning protection and communication in one cable.
  • Cost-effective: Reduces the need for separate communication lines.
  • Reliable data transmission: Supports high-bandwidth, low-attenuation communication over long distances.
  • Durable and resilient: Withstands harsh environmental conditions and mechanical stress.
  • Supports smart grid infrastructure: Enables real-time monitoring, automated control, and proactive maintenance .

Standards and Specifications

OPGW cables are manufactured according to IEC, IEEE, and other international standards, ensuring performance, safety, and long-term reliability. Fiber counts typically range from 6 to 144 fibers, depending on utility requirements and project specifications .
